In February 2007, E.ON launched a new retail subsidiary that makes customer choice easy. Its name explains its approach: E WIE EINFACH. Which is German for "E as in Easy." E WIE EINFACH is the first retailer to offer power and gas service nationwide, making it easy for residential and small business customers across Germany to switch providers. And it has a rate plan that makes saving easy, too. E WIE EINFACH's prices are guaranteed to be cheaper--by 1 cent per kilowatt-hour for power and by 2 cents per cubic meter for natural gas--than customers' local incumbent supplier. The easy approach has paid off. In just twelve months, 660,000 customers have switched to E WIE EINFACH. Our subsidiary's success has spurred retail competition in Germany. That's evident from the many suppliers that have followed our example. And from the number of customers who have switched. By the third quarter of 2007, the switch rate had reached 11 percent, an increase that's demonstrably the result of our pacesetting approach.
